When Should We Call for Crime Scene Cleanup?

There are several occasions that necessitate the need for crime scene cleanup. 

  • Call for crime scene cleanup when you are dealing with the physical aftermath of a traumatic event like suicide, accidental death, homicide, or some other type of trauma Knowing that someone else will be responsible for cleanup can help make things much easier on your psyche.
  • Call for crime scene cleanup when you need to have biohazardous waste removed from the scene of a trauma or crime. Biohazardous waste includes blood, body tissue, and bodily fluids. This type of waste can be dangerous because it carries dangerous pathogens like bacteria and viruses. Exposure to these pathogens can cause disease spread
  • Reach out for crime scene cleanup if you have a difficult-to-handle crime or trauma scene that needs cleaning. Blood, human waste, or chemicals that have gotten into materials like rugs or curtains can be extremely difficult to remove. Some of that matter changes to a nearly impossible to remove consistency over time. Removal of those items will require special equipment, chemicals, and solvents. We have everything we need to remove all types of difficult substances. If a substance is unable to be removed, the item will have to be destroyed. We’ll work with our clients every step of the way so they’ll know exactly which items are not salvageable. It’s important to know that contaminated items that can’t be cleaned have to be destroyed in order to protect the public. 
  • Call for crime scene cleaning services if you’re dealing with a crime scene that has a noxious odor that’s difficult to remove. We have tools at our disposal to help with this type of issue. That list includes industrial-strength hepa filters, ozone generator machines, air scrubbers, and hydroxyl generators that use strong UV light to locate and eliminate pollutants. 

What Goes Into the Cost of Cleanup?

There are several different factors that determine how much crime scene cleaning costs.

Size of the Space

We’ll have to take a look at the size of the space so that we can calculate the size of the area that needs to be cleaned. We’ll look at the type and amount of biohazardous waste in the space so that we can figure out which products and tools we’ll need to use to remove it. Some cleaning processes take a lot of time to execute, so which ones we use and how long we have to use them will ultimately impact pricing. 

Material Porosity

The porosity of the surfaces also makes a difference in determining crime scene costs. Surfaces that are extremely porous will require stronger, deep-down cleaning, while those that are less porous will take less time to clean. The amount of items in the room will also determine how long cleaning will take and how much it will cost. Rooms filled with tons of tucked-away spaces, nooks and crannies or filled with furnishings like carpets and curtains will take longer to clean out. We’ll have to determine which items can be cleaned and which items can’t be saved.

What Are the Steps Involved in Crime Scene Cleanup?

Following is a list of the general steps involved in crime scene clean-up. Each crime scene will differ from the next, so the specific steps for each will vary.

  • The team will gear up with PPE. This will include items like face mask goggles, full respirator masks, shoe coverings, face shields and gloves
  • We will then dispose of everything in the space that we’re unable to clean. We will place all of these pieces into Hazmat bags or bins so that they can be disposed of safely and properly. Each type of biohazard waste will have its own bin. Examples of items that can’t be disinfected and cleaned include items like upholstered furniture, carpeting, and certain types of electronics.
  • We will disinfect and remove all of the items from the scene items that can be disinfected. This will help prevent them from becoming re-contaminated as we clean the rest of the room.
  • Our teams will map out a plan for the cleaning and scrubbing of walls and floors. Many teams work from the top down. This method helps prevent them from reinfecting lower areas in the room.
  • We’ll use putty knives and other utensils to scrape away dried material. There are certain solvents that are good at loosening and dissolving specific types of biohazardous waste.
  • We’ll use equipment like wet vacuums, long-reach mops, and scrubbers in addition to special chemicals to scrub the entire space. This step will only begin once the rest of the room has been completely cleared.
  • We will then begin the disinfection process. The disinfectants we use include OSHA and EPA approved chemicals and solvents as well as special machines like ozone generators.
  • Once the space has been completely sanitized, disinfected and cleaned, we’ll transport the hazmat bags and any other trash away from the site.
